DDMRRR, DDMA Kupwara host workshop on Incident Response System at Kupwara

Kupwara : Department of Disaster Management, Relief, Rehabilitation and Reconstruction (DDMRRR), in a joint effort with the District Disaster Management Authority (DDMA) Kupwara, successfully conducted a day-long workshop focused on the Incident Response System (IRS).
The training program which was held Monday at the Conference Hall of the D.C. Office Kupwara was chaired by Deputy Commissioner/ Chairman DDMA Kupwara, Shrikant Balasaheb Suse.
Additional Deputy Commissioner (ADC) Kupwara (CEO DDMA), Gulzar Ahmad; ADC Handwara, Javaid Naseem Masoodi; SDM Lolab, CPO, Dy. SP SDRF Kupwara, Dy. SP NDRF Srinagar, besides, officers from Fire & Emergency Service, Civil Defence, Health, Police, PWD, Revenue, Education, Information and other departments attended the workshop.
The workshop was organised to enhance the preparedness and coordination of various stakeholders in managing and responding to disasters and emergencies. The training aimed to familiarize participants with the principles and structure of the Incident Response System, a standardized on-scene emergency management framework.
Speaking at the occasion, Chairman DDMA impressed upon the participants to take maximum benefit from the workshop about their key role in dealing with the disaster like situations. He appreciated the department for organizing the training workshop and stressed conduct of mock drills in coming days.
Snober Jameel, Deputy Secretary, DDMRRR briefed the participants about their respective roles in the Incident Response System at district, sub division and tehsil levels. Awareness about different types of natural and manmade disasters like earthquake, flood, hailstorm, landslides, avalanches, high velocity winds, snow storms, forest fires, road & industrial accidents were provided to the participants.
Expert Brig. Kuldeep Singh who is former consultant of NDMA also shared his deep insights with the participants through online mode about the implementation of IRS on ground.
Throughout the day, experts and trainers in disaster management provided comprehensive sessions on the key components of the IRS. The program emphasized practical knowledge and skills to ensure a swift, effective, and coordinated response during disaster.
